Holland relieved to avoid extra time

Chelsea assistant manager Steve Holland has admitted that he was glad to avoid extra time in their League Cup clash with Championship outfit Bolton Wanderers.

The Blues progressed to the fourth round with a 2-1 win, courtesy of goals from Kurt Zouma and Oscar either side of a Matt Mills strike.

"It's nice not to have extra time. We don't have any new injuries, we've progressed to the next round of the competition," he told reporters.

"Several of our players who probably needed a game now have 90 minutes under their belts heading into two or three important fixtures. It's a good situation to be in."

Chelsea have been drawn against Shrewsbury Town in the next phase.
